Questions must now be answered on Met’s wider use of strip search

Answers to vital questions about the Met’s wider use of strip search must be provided, says the Liberal Democrat London Assembly Member Caroline Pidgeon.

In a letter to the Deputy Mayor for Policing and Crime, Caroline asks for the answers to five key questions.

Caroline’s letter follows the publication this week of the safeguarding report that found that at the end of 2020, a 15-year old Black girl was strip searched by Metropolitan Police officers at her school without another adult present and in the knowledge that she was menstruating

Caroline Pidgeon said:

“This is a deeply shocking case which has had an immense impact on this young girl and her family.

“Despite the IOPC announcing they will look into this case, it is vital that action is taken to improve practices more widely and ensure a case like this never occurs again.”
